Casablanca: Spanish-designed Gaictech tuna processing plant for Tunamax targets Europe and North America

A Spanish-designed complex in Casablanca is now moving into full-scale operations, aiming to speed up throughput, improve cleanliness and turn out export-ready tuna for supermarket shelves across Europe and North America.

A new heavyweight in the global tuna trade

Gaictech, a Spanish engineering company, has finished what is being presented as Morocco’s biggest industrial tuna processing plant. The site was built for the Moroccan group Tunamax and is located in Casablanca’s port area.

Rather than stitching together a set of disconnected lines, the factory has been planned as one end-to-end system that covers the entire tuna value chain. It is set up to take in frozen or fresh fish and carry it right through to sealed cans and pouches.

The plant’s automation allows rapid processing, lower waste and full traceability, aligned with strict EU and US market rules.

Together, those features give Casablanca a more strategic position in a sector traditionally dominated by Asian centres such as Thailand and the Philippines, alongside long-established European processors in Spain, Portugal and Italy.

How Spanish technology underpins the Casablanca plant

Gaictech, which focuses on turnkey equipment for food manufacturing, led the design, systems integration and commissioning of the production lines.

Its equipment links nearly every stage in the workflow:

  • Reception and grading of the tuna
  • Controlled cooking to preserve texture and flavour
  • Cleaning and trimming of loins
  • Filling of cans, jars or pouches
  • Sealing and sterilisation under precise conditions
  • Final packaging and palletising for export

Automation is used extensively throughout the facility, spanning conveyor networks, intelligent weighing points and digital supervision of timing, temperature and hygiene.

Traceability software links each batch of tuna to data on origin, processing time, temperature and destination client, creating an auditable digital trail.

This level of monitoring has effectively become a baseline expectation for retailers in the European Union and North America, where both regulators and shoppers are paying closer attention to food safety, provenance and environmental impact.

Why the plant matters for Morocco’s economy

The development is viewed as more than the construction of another factory. Government bodies and industry stakeholders in Morocco see it as part of a wider move to keep more value from the country’s fish resources at home.

For a long time, significant volumes of Moroccan tuna have left the country with limited processing, while the higher-margin steps - cooking, canning and branding - were carried out abroad. In practice, fishermen and ports benefited, but factories and industrial service providers inside Morocco often captured less of the upside.

By localising cooking, cleaning, canning and packaging, the plant aims to retain a larger share of tuna’s added value in Morocco.

The plant is expected to generate hundreds of direct roles on the lines, particularly in processing, quality assurance and maintenance. Beyond those jobs, it also supports a broader network forming in Casablanca and nearby areas:

Sector Expected impact
Transport and logistics More freight movements to ports, cold-chain services and container handling
Packaging Higher demand for cans, lids, labels and cardboard
Industrial services Work for engineers, electricians, automation technicians and cleaners
Local suppliers Greater use of regional firms for civil works, maintenance and spare parts

Morocco has already positioned itself as a production base for cars, aviation and textiles; increasingly, high-specification food processing is becoming another important pillar. Tuna is particularly appealing because demand for shelf-stable protein tends to remain resilient, even during periods of economic uncertainty.

Export ambitions: eyes on Europe and North America

Tunamax has designed the Casablanca complex around export agreements rather than mainly serving domestic demand. A sizeable portion of output is already allocated to supermarket groups and multinational brands.

For those buyers, compliance is not limited to hygiene paperwork. They typically require assured volumes, consistent quality, exact pack formats and strict delivery timetables - needs that the plant’s scale and automation are intended to support.

The factory aims to serve large, long-term contracts, positioning Casablanca as a reliable supply hub for branded tuna lines on foreign shelves.

Morocco’s closeness to major European ports can also shorten transit times compared with Asian rivals. That geographic advantage may lower shipping costs and reduce the carbon footprint of deliveries, which is becoming a more prominent factor in retailer sourcing decisions.

Competing with Asian and European giants

Tuna processing is intensely competitive worldwide. Asian operators often have the advantage of lower costs and decades of large-scale production. European facilities frequently compete on reputation, established brands and close integration with EU supermarket supply chains.

The Casablanca site is intended to blend elements of both approaches: North African cost advantages paired with technology, certification and process control that sits nearer to European expectations.

The Spanish role further supports credibility with EU customers, many of whom already purchase from Spanish tuna brands or have experience working with Spanish engineering suppliers.

Spanish engineering companies widen their global reach

For Gaictech, the Casablanca build is also a demonstration project. Its business model centres on turnkey delivery - not only providing machinery, but also planning the layout, linking the systems and managing start-up.

Demand for that approach has grown as food manufacturers increasingly prefer a single partner for complex upgrades rather than coordinating dozens of separate suppliers. In Casablanca, Gaictech took responsibility for:

  • Designing production flows to avoid product cross-contamination
  • Selecting and integrating cooking, cooling and filling equipment
  • Automation systems and digital control panels
  • Training of local staff on operation and maintenance

The contract reinforces Spain’s standing as a reference point for fish-processing technology. Spanish shipyards and engineering companies already supply vessels, cold-storage infrastructure and canning equipment to multiple countries that operate sizeable tuna fleets.

What this means for tuna on your plate

For shoppers in London, New York or Berlin, a new facility in Casablanca may seem distant. Even so, it could influence what appears on supermarket shelves within the next few years.

Retailers seeking alternative supply options - particularly after recent disruption to shipping routes and volatility in raw material prices - may view Morocco as a way to diversify beyond a small number of Asian plants. This can help keep prices steadier and reduce the risk of sudden shortages.

Greater emphasis on traceability will also be reflected in packaging. Tuna packed in Casablanca is likely to carry clearer information about catch area, the processing plant and, depending on brand policy, possibly the fishing method.

Stronger traceability and local processing help buyers check that tuna complies with fishing rules, food safety laws and brand commitments.

For brands that promote sustainability messaging, sourcing from a facility that shares detailed data and sits closer to destination markets can also become a useful marketing point.

Key concepts: traceability, added value and food safety

Three technical phrases are frequently used when discussing the Casablanca project: traceability, added value and food safety standards.

Traceability is the ability to follow a product from the fishing vessel through to the supermarket. In the tuna sector, this typically covers information such as:

  • Where and when the fish was caught
  • Which vessel and gear were used
  • How the tuna was stored and transported
  • Which plant processed and canned it

Added value describes the extra economic worth created when raw tuna is turned into a ready-to-eat product. Steps like cleaning, cooking, canning, branding and logistics add value on top of the initial catch. When those activities happen domestically, Morocco retains a larger share of that value within its own economy.

Food safety standards include tight limits on contaminants, proof of hygienic handling and correct heat treatment to ensure shelf stability. For canned tuna sold in Europe or the US, failing an inspection can lead to shipments being blocked and significant financial losses.

Risks and opportunities for the regional tuna industry

A facility on this scale creates clear opportunities as well as potential difficulties. On the upside, it can provide steadier demand for local fishing fleets, support industrial employment and attract investment into cold storage, ports and workforce training.

However, expansion also carries risks if it is not matched by careful stewardship of tuna stocks. Overfishing would threaten the very resource the plant relies on, making coordination with fisheries authorities and international organisations essential.

There is also the risk of buyer concentration. If contracts are controlled by a small number of large purchasers, they may push prices down. That pressure can compress margins for plant operators and create incentives to cut costs on maintenance or labour. Robust local regulation and transparent auditing can help prevent those pressures from eroding standards.

At the same time, the Casablanca complex could serve as a template for other African coastal countries looking to move further up the seafood value chain. If similar projects are rolled out with sustainability at their core, parts of the global tuna industry could shift closer to the waters where fish are caught, altering trade patterns over the next decade.
